    I am attempting to purify a mixture of methane and CO2 by water scrubbing in an absorption column. I understand that implementing Henry's coefficients should be important.

    I tried using both the native absorption column as well the one provided by ChemSep. While the data from Chemsep always showed an increase in CO2 percentage, the results from native DWSIM column were more sensible and methane percentage increased.

    I used the Roult model because I read in the forum that it takes care of the Henry's constants. However, irrespective of the no of stages the methane percentage was stuck close to 61%. What am I missing here ?
    Any pointers will be useful.

    Also any pointers how to do it in ChemSep would be useful. I ticked the Henry's constant in Chemsep but it refused to scrub methane.

    I got it. The water was getting saturated. When I increased water flow the system worked in the native absorber but the ChemSep sim still does not work.

    Fixed the ChemSep one as well. Stupid mistake. The inlet lean water had gas components by mistake. Just learned that one needs to click "Accept changes" after changing and pressing enter is not sufficient.
